CMUcam3 是完全开源且可编程的吗?#
Yes, that's the point! You can use GCC to compile code and the board can be flashed over any serial port. No need to buy a jtag dongle or any other programming device. 您可以在 Windows、Linux 和 Mac 上进行开发吗?#
是的!在 Windows 下使用 Cygwin,在 Linux 和 Mac 上使用您的标准环境。一旦您在 /dev/目录中找到您的串行端口名称,串行命令行下载器应该可以在 Mac 上工作。对于 Mac,您需要从源代码编译 arm-gcc。我们很快将提供可执行文件。
用于 CMUcam3 的 CMUcam2 固件完全相同吗?#
还不完全是,但也许将来会。我们认为我们已经实现了最常用的功能。您拥有源代码,因此可以自己添加任何缺失的功能。
我应该购买 CMUcam、CMUcam2 还是 CMUcam3?#
That depends. The CMUcam and CMUcam2 are designed as fully integrated sensor sub-systems that you use as a black-box. The CMUcam3 can eventually be used in the same way, however you may need to design your own functionality for it. The easiest way to do this is to tailor existing CMUcam3 projects for your application. The CMUcam3's major advantage is that it is open source and programmable. So you can easily modify or write your own firmware to run on it. As a black-box system, the CMUcam3 supports most but not all of the CMUcam2 functionality. We ported over the features that we saw people using most often. Some of the CMUcam3's other functionality (like the face detector) requires flashing the CMUcam with different firmware images. That being said, even the CMUcam2 firmware emulation on the CMUcam3 has some extra features like jpeg making it more powerful than the original CMUcam2. The CMUcam3 has a more powerful processor and an SD slot for FLASH storage. The original CMUcam is your best bet if cost is your main concern.
